Several factors are propelling the growth of the dental pipette market. The increasing prevalence of complex dental procedures, such as dental implants and cosmetic dentistry, necessitates the precise handling of small volumes of liquids, solidifying the role of dental pipettes. The rising global geriatric population, with its associated higher incidence of dental issues, fuels the demand for advanced dental care, including procedures that rely heavily on accurate liquid dispensing. Simultaneously, heightened awareness of oral health and hygiene is driving increased visits to dental clinics and laboratories, further boosting the need for efficient and reliable dental pipettes. Technological advancements, leading to the development of ergonomic, automated, and more precise pipettes, improve workflow efficiency and reduce the risk of errors in dental laboratories. The growing adoption of disposable pipette tips enhances hygiene and minimizes the risk of cross-contamination, which is crucial in a clinical setting. Government initiatives focused on improving oral health infrastructure and research funding for dental technology further contribute to the market's expansion. Finally, the increasing availability of training and educational resources for dental professionals on proper pipette usage ensures the widespread and effective utilization of these critical tools.
Despite the significant growth potential, the dental pipette market faces certain challenges. High initial investment costs associated with purchasing advanced dental pipettes can be a barrier, particularly for smaller clinics or dental laboratories with limited budgets. Furthermore, the need for regular calibration and maintenance of these instruments to ensure accuracy can add to the overall operational costs. Stringent regulatory requirements and quality control standards necessitate rigorous testing and validation, potentially increasing time to market for new products. The potential for human error during pipette operation remains a concern, even with advanced technologies, highlighting the need for comprehensive training programs for dental professionals. The market is also susceptible to fluctuations in raw material prices and supply chain disruptions, which can impact the cost and availability of dental pipettes. Finally, the existence of cost-effective alternatives to some dental pipette applications, and competition from other liquid handling technologies, might limit market penetration in specific segments.
